Transaction

4bb98c7271e09199eb6c321148fe3f87ce3cdfae487ea84b2adfa1d3923c8fe2
266,785 confirmations
Timestamp
1615323453
Block673,901
Fee18,771 sats
Fee rate99.3 sats/vB
view on mempool.space

Inputs & Outputs